Salafs sayings

It is reported that Imām Al-Zuhrī – Allāh have mercy on him – said:

Those of our scholars who went before us used to say,”Adherence to the Sunnah is salvation, but knowledge is taken away quickly, so the revival of knowledge means the stability of religion and worldly affairs, and the loss of knowledge means the loss of all that.”

Al-Lālakā`ī, Sharh Usūl I’tiqād Ahl Al-Sunnah article 136

The Ruling on praying more than One Obligatory Prayer with a Single Ablution

 


Question:

Is it permissible for us to pray two obligatory prayers with a single ablution, without intention?
Answer:

Yes, it is permissible for a person to pray the Zuhr prayer for example, after making Wudhu, then when the time comes for Asr prayer, if he is still in a state of purity, to pray that prayer with the ablution of Zuhr, even if he did not make the intention when he performed the ablution to pray two obligatory prayers. This is because the ablution that he made for Zuhr, removed any impurities from him, and if impurity is removed, it does not return without cause, which is any of the well known things which nullify Wudhu. Indeed, when a person performs Wudhu, without the intention of prayer, such as when he does so in order to remove impurity only, he may pray as much as he wishes of the obligatory and the non-obligatory prayers, until his ablution is invalidated.
Shaykh Muhammad bin Saalih al-`Uthaymeen
Fatawa Islamiyah Vol. 2 Page 225
